Transaction 626e10a1870e294ce2c818d1a3df93f0684eb65ae8e22c2e6f1e65b85081eaf3

1 Input
2 Outputs
  • 626e10a1870e294ce2c818d1a3df93f0684eb65ae8e22c2e6f1e65b85081eaf3:0
  • value  18253003
    address  142QfPgmGonG6WTqsNyZo2SXxZiPwG2jwV
  • 626e10a1870e294ce2c818d1a3df93f0684eb65ae8e22c2e6f1e65b85081eaf3:1
  • value  3597852763
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F